Scratch is fixed, and rattles are gone...for now.

So far its got about 850 miles on it. Here's what I like/don't like about it so far :

Likes
--------
* As I mentioned before, the ride quality is TONS better than the '01 I had.
* Seats are also a lot more comfortable, having them heated is nice, too.
* The longer wheelbase really makes the interior very roomy, and its also wider up front.
* The 17" rims. BTW, it still a plastic cover :mad:

Dislikes
--------
* Acceleration is adequate, but this car should have had AT LEAST 220hp from the factory - no questions asked. Torque steer is very evident, as it was in the GA. Don't get me wrong, the car will still get up and go, but I thought the acceleration would be a little better.
* Steering isn't as responsive and feels strange. Electric assist steering is used in this as opposed to hydraulic.
* UNPAINTED MIRRORS! GET WITH IT GM...THIS IS 2005 AND THIS IS A $27,000 CAR!! IS IT REALLY THAT MUCH MORE $$ TO PAINT THE MIRRORS?! :confused: Black plastic mirrors just don't cut it in my book.
* H11 bulbs for lows, H9's for highs. Hardly anyone makes a DECENT bulb to replace these. No Silverstars yet in this size. There are lots of "plasma" junk bulbs out there in this size however..go figure.

Verdict
--------
I'm more impressed overall with this car than I thought I would be. Hopefully the rattles stay away for a while.
